Why Invest in a Pool Monitoring System?

Traditional pool maintenance relies heavily on manual testing and adjustments. This method is time-consuming, potentially inaccurate, and leaves room for human error. Ignoring crucial factors like pH imbalance, sanitizer levels, or equipment malfunctions can lead to several problems:
Health Risks: Improperly balanced water can cause skin and eye irritation, and insufficient sanitization can lead to bacterial and algae growth, posing significant health risks to swimmers.
Equipment Damage: Ignoring chemical imbalances or equipment issues can damage pool pumps, filters, and other vital components, leading to costly repairs or replacements.
Wasted Resources: Manual adjustments often lead to over- or under-treatment of chemicals, resulting in wasted resources and unnecessary expenses.
Time Inefficiency: Regularly testing and adjusting pool chemicals manually consumes considerable time and effort.

A pool monitoring system eliminates these challenges by providing continuous, real-time data on crucial pool parameters. This enables proactive adjustments, prevents costly problems, and ensures a consistently safe and enjoyable swimming experience.

Types of Pool Monitoring Systems:

The market offers a range of pool monitoring systems, each with its unique features and capabilities:

1. Basic Digital Controllers: These are entry-level systems that typically monitor and control pH and sanitizer levels. They offer automated chemical dispensing but require manual testing for confirmation. While less expensive, they lack the sophisticated features of more advanced systems.

2. Advanced Digital Controllers with Automated Monitoring: These systems build upon basic controllers by incorporating sensors for continuous monitoring of key parameters, including temperature, pH, ORP (oxidation-reduction potential), and free chlorine. They automatically adjust chemical levels and provide alerts for potential issues. This level of automation minimizes manual intervention and provides greater precision in maintaining ideal pool conditions.

3. Smart Pool Monitoring Systems: These are the most sophisticated systems on the market. They combine advanced digital controllers with remote monitoring capabilities via a smartphone app or web interface. This allows users to monitor their pool's condition from anywhere, receive real-time alerts, and make adjustments remotely. Many smart systems integrate with other smart home devices and offer advanced features like predictive maintenance and energy management.

4. IoT (Internet of Things) Integrated Systems: These systems leverage the power of IoT to connect various pool components and provide comprehensive data analysis. They can integrate with sensors throughout the pool system, providing a holistic view of its health and performance. This level of integration enables predictive maintenance, optimized chemical usage, and enhanced energy efficiency.

Key Features to Consider When Choosing a System:
Parameters Monitored: Consider the specific parameters you want to monitor (pH, chlorine, temperature, ORP, etc.).
Automation Level: Determine the degree of automation you require, from basic adjustments to fully automated control.
Connectivity: If remote monitoring and control are important, ensure the system offers smartphone app or web interface compatibility.
Alert System: A robust alert system is crucial for timely intervention in case of potential problems.
Ease of Use: Choose a system with a user-friendly interface and straightforward setup and operation.
Integration Capabilities: Consider the system's ability to integrate with other smart home devices or existing pool equipment.
Cost: Pool monitoring systems vary significantly in price. Balance the cost with the features and benefits offered.
Maintenance: Investigate the ongoing maintenance requirements, including sensor calibration and replacement.
